Rebecca and John Moores Comprehensive Cancer Center, La Jolla

The La Jolla treatment facility is located on the University of California, San Diego campus in the Rebecca and John Moores Comprehensive Cancer Center , one of only 39 NCI-designated Cancer Centers in the United States.

The La Jolla Center is divided into two separate facilities. The West Facility is located within the Cancer Center itself, the East Facility (which is currently under construction) is located adjacent to the Cancer Center.

Patients are seen and treated in both facilities. The anticipated completion date of the West Facility is early 2008.

Occupying approximately 31,000 square feet with 4 treatment vaults, the La Jolla Facility is the primary treatment and administrative center of the UCSD Department.

All patients are treated on state-of-the-art Varian Linear Accelerators including 2 Trilogy units.  One treatment vault is also used for the development of cutting edge technologies under a Master Research Agreement with Varian Medical Systems, Inc. 

The center also is also equipped with a large bore GE LightSpeed CT simulator, Varian RPM gating systems, and a dedicated HDR Brachytherapy Suite.

The Encinitas facility is located within the San Diego Cancer Center http://www.sdcancer.com/ in Encinitas, California. 

Occupying over 7500 square feet, the Encinitas Facility is the North County Coastal satellite of the Department.  As in the La Jolla facility, patients are treated state-of-the-art equipment including a Varian Trilogy Linear Accelerator. 

The Encinitas Center is currently under construction (expected completion date late summer 2008).  North County patients are currently seen at the Encinitas clinic but treatment is delivered at the La Jolla facility.

Hospitals                                                                                                                   

The UCSD Radiation Oncology Department is affiliated with 4 hospitals in the San Diego area:  Thornton Hospital, Hillcrest Hospital, Rady Children’s Hospital and the VA Hospital. 

Inpatients at these hospitals undergoing radiation therapy receive their treatment at our La Jolla facility.
